在面板里安装了两次nginx仍然提示未安装nginx
时间 : 2024-01-13 21:45: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
在面板里安装了两次nginx,但仍然提示未安装nginx的问题可能是由于一些常见原因导致的。下面是可能的原因和解决方案:
1. 安装路径错误:在安装nginx时,确保选择了正确的安装路径。默认情况下,nginx通常被安装在`/usr/local/nginx`目录下。您可以通过检查该目录是否存在来验证nginx是否正确安装。
解决方案:重新安装nginx时,请确保选择正确的安装路径。
2. 配置文件缺失:nginx的配置文件通常位于安装路径下的`conf`目录中,文件名为`nginx.conf`。如果配置文件缺失,nginx将无法正常启动并提示未安装的错误。
解决方案:请检查`conf`目录下是否存在`nginx.conf`文件,如果不存在,请复制一份示例配置文件或尝试重新安装nginx。
3. 服务未启动:即使nginx已经安装成功,也需要手动启动nginx服务才能正常运行。如果服务未启动,则会出现未安装的提示。
解决方案:启动nginx服务。在终端中运行以下命令启动nginx服务:
sudo service nginx start
或者,使用以下命令重启nginx服务:
sudo service nginx restart
4. 防火墙阻止:防火墙可能会阻止对nginx的访问,导致提示未安装的错误。请确保防火墙允许对nginx的流量通过。
解决方案:打开终端,并尝试停止防火墙或者允许nginx的流量通过:
sudo ufw disable
或者,允许nginx的流量通过:
sudo ufw allow 'Nginx Full'
5. 其他问题:如果上述解决方案都没有解决问题,可能还存在其他问题,例如文件权限问题、依赖项问题等。
解决方案:尝试使用`root`权限运行安装命令,检查文件权限,确保所有依赖项都已正确安装。
总结:在面板里安装nginx两次仍然提示未安装nginx的问题可能是由于安装路径错误、配置文件缺失、服务未启动、防火墙阻止或其他问题导致的。根据具体情况,可以尝试重新安装、检查配置文件、启动服务、允许流量通过防火墙等解决方案来解决该问题。如果仍然无法解决,请考虑查阅相关文档或寻求专业人士的帮助。
其他答案
在面板里安装了两次nginx仍然提示未安装nginx
如果您在面板中已经尝试过两次安装Nginx,但仍然收到"未安装Nginx"的提示,可能是由于以下几个原因:
1. 安装过程中出现了错误:Nginx的安装过程可能因为各种原因中断或出现错误,导致安装不成功。您可以检查安装过程中的日志文件,通常位于/var/log目录下,查看是否有任何错误或异常信息。
2. 面板配置错误:面板可能出现了一些配置问题,导致无法正确检测到Nginx的安装状态。您可以尝试重启面板服务,或者检查面板的配置文件是否正确设置了Nginx的安装路径和相关信息。
3. 系统依赖问题:要正确安装Nginx,您的系统需要满足一些依赖关系,如gcc、make等。请确保您的系统已经安装了这些依赖库,并且版本是兼容的。
解决该问题的步骤如下:
1. 检查错误日志:查看Nginx安装过程中的日志文件,以确定是否有错误或异常信息。您可以使用命令`tail -f /var/log/nginx/error.log`来实时查看Nginx的错误日志。
2. 重新安装:如果在安装过程中出现了错误,可以尝试重新安装Nginx。在安装之前,确保面板已经正确安装并配置了所需的依赖。安装需要一些时间,请耐心等待安装过程完成。
3. 检查面板配置:检查面板的配置文件是否正确设置了Nginx的安装路径和相关信息。您可以通过编辑面板配置文件,通常位于/etc/nginx/conf.d目录下,来查看和修改配置信息。
4. 检查系统依赖:确保您的系统已经安装了Nginx所需的依赖关系,如gcc、make等。您可以使用命令`yum install gcc make`来安装这些依赖关系。
如果您仍然无法成功安装Nginx或解决问题,请尝试在相关的技术论坛或社区寻求帮助。提供更详细的错误信息和操作步骤,有助于他人更好地理解和解决您的问题。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章